What to expect
Queen's View
Highlands of Scotland - Stop at Queens View the iconic view said to have been a favourite of queens, overlooking Loch Tummel. Experience the Hermitage where you take a fantastic woodland walk leading up to the Black Linn Falls. Visit Callander the town regarded as the Gateway to the Highlands, or Balquhidder the location of Rob Roy's grave. Pitlochry a favourite of Queen Victoria
Loch Lomond
Loch Lomond & The Trossachs National Park - Explore one of Scotland's national treasures Loch Lomond, this area of outstanding natural beauty straddles the cultural and physical boundaries of the Highlands and Lowlands of Scotland.
The Glenturret Distillery
Whisky Distilley - There are many distillieries to visit, all offer tours ranging from understanding the process from grain to bottle to a full tour of the distillery including the Warehouse.Taste the "Water if Life" and learn to love it like a true Scotman.
Doune Castle
Scottish Castles & Palaces - Stirling Castle with its historical importance to Linlithgow Palace the birthplace of Mary Queen of Scots. Doune Castle is one of the best preserved Medieval castle in Scotland. It has also featured in "Outlander" and "Game of Thrones". There are many more to visit too.
Loch Katrine
Scottish Lochs - Walk the shores of a Scottish Loch or even take a cruise aboard The Steamship "Sir Walter Scott" on Loch Katrine.
The Battle of Bannockburn Experience
Scottish Battle Sites - Take your place on the site where Robert the Bruce fought against in the English at the Battle of Bannockburn.
Fife Coastal Route
Kingdom of Fife & Fishing Villages - Be charmed by the cobbled lanes of Anstruther one of Scotlands traditional fishing villages, the quaint town of Falkland with its beautiful Palace. Immerse yourself in 1,000 years of history in St Andrews or visit The Old Course "The Home of Golf".
Forth Bridge
The Forth Bridges - Iconic and historic, Scotland's Forth Bridges are a wonder of the modern world. Towering side by side over the Forth, these structures represent the pinnacle of engineering from three centuries and offer a vaction photo to remember.
